Output 5e689f626a26d554230e73a8dbd9d5e4617491917e34990326f6e2964924d7d3:0

value
741100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6713574c6c9f4748c8e578e4c307ae9b9587e933 OP_EQUAL
address
3B62h92ZrwShtftVnTEwK1T6KMt6bH46L2
transaction
5e689f626a26d554230e73a8dbd9d5e4617491917e34990326f6e2964924d7d3
confirmations
133548
spent
true